What is cube cut?

“Cube” means to cut food into pieces that are even, like a square. The size is usually about the same as the chopped pieces sizes; about 1/3 to 1/2″. “Dice” means to cut food into even, small squares about 1/4″ in diameter.

What is julienned cut vegetables?

The food is cut into long thin strips in this cutting vegetables. The finely French cut slices look like match sticks. Carrots, celery, and potatoes are the most common veggies to be julienned for carrot julienne, celeries remoulade, and julienne fries.
